The Yankees could miss out on Eugenio Suarez because he is in demand in the National League

With the MLB trade deadline fast approaching, the New York Yankees are still looking for offensive reinforcements to bolster their lineup for the stretch run. One of the names that has been mentioned in recent weeks is Venezuelan third baseman Eugenio Suarez, currently a figure with the Arizona Diamondbacks and home run leader in the National League

However, the Yankees could be left empty-handed because National League teams such as the Cincinnati Reds, his former team, have begun active talks with Arizona to seek a trade. Journalist Trent Rosecrans reported that there is mutual interest between the Reds and Diamondbacks to bring the slugger back.

Eugenio Suarez is having a great year and attracting suitors from the National League

At 34 years of age, Eugenio Suarez is having an explosive season with 36 home runs and 86 RBIs, which ranks him among the most productive players in 2025. His level has attracted the interest of several teams, especially in the National League, where his power could be a decisive factor in an increasingly tight postseason race.

His former club, the Reds, would be particularly interested in bringing him back. Suarez played in Cincinnati between 2015 and 2021, leaving very solid numbers with an average of .253/.335/.475 and 189 home runs, becoming a fan favorite. The Venezuelan’s possible return would be, according to analysts, an emotional and sporting blow that would be very well received at the Great American Ball Park.

Obstacles in negotiations and the risk for the Yankees

Although talks with the Diamondbacks and Reds are real, some experts do not see it as feasible for an immediate deal to be reached. MLB journalist Mark Feinsand noted that “the Reds and Arizona have talked about Eugenio Suarez, but some sources consider it unlikely that a deal will be finalized.” Even so, he suggests that Arizona is willing to move several pieces with expiring contracts, including Suarez, Josh Naylor, Zac Gallen and Merrill Kelly.

Meanwhile, the Yankees risk losing another key piece in their bid to shore up the infield, as the high competition from the National League could close the player’s access, especially if Arizona prefers to trade him from its own circuit to avoid a crossover with New York in a possible World Series.
